MLOps is a set of repeatable, automated, and collaborative workflows with best practices that empower teams of ML professionals to quickly and easily get their machine learning models deployed into production. :computer: Getting Started This repository will focus on online inference scenarios that integrate Azure Databricks with other Azure services to deploy machine learning models as web services. Out-of-the-box capabilities of Azure Databricks will be used to build machine learning models, but the deployment and monitoring of these models will be done using Azure Container Apps or Azure Kubernetes Service. All example scenarios will focus on classical machine learning problems. An adapted version of the UCI Credit Card Client Default dataset will be used to illustrate each example scenario.
